Common Signs of a Failing BCM

If your vehicle is showing these symptoms, a faulty BCM is the likely cause. Look out for communication-related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s), such as U0140, U0155, or B1001.

  • ✔ Unpredictable power windows, door locks, or interior lights.
  • ✔ The security or anti-theft light stays on, preventing the car from starting.
  • ✔ Horn honking unexpectedly or not working at all.
  • ✔ Wipers operating on their own or not responding to the switch.
  • ✔ Inaccurate or dead gauges on the instrument cluster.
  • ✔ Intermittent no-crank, no-start condition.
  • ✔ Communication errors with other modules on the vehicle’s network.

A Straightforward Guide to Installation

Our cloning service makes installing your replacement 2008-2009 G8 BCM a simple process. While the exact location can vary, the G8 BCM is typically found in the center dash area.

  1. Safety First: Disconnect the negative terminal from your vehicle’s battery to prevent any electrical shorts.
  2. Locate the BCM: On the Pontiac G8, you’ll generally find the BCM behind the glove box or in the center console area. You may need to remove some trim panels for access.
  3. Disconnect and Remove: Carefully unplug the electrical connectors from the old BCM. They have locking tabs that need to be depressed. Once disconnected, unbolt the module from its mounting bracket.
  4. Install the New Module: Mount your new, cloned BCM in the same position and securely fasten it. Reconnect all electrical connectors, ensuring they click into place.
  5. Reconnect Power: Reattach the negative battery terminal.
  6. Test All Functions: Start the vehicle and test all related functions: power windows, locks, wipers, lights, and radio to confirm the repair is successful.

Important Post-Installation Steps

In most cases, our cloning service makes this a plug-and-play repair. However, with complex vehicle systems, a couple of relearn procedures may be necessary:

  • Airbag System Sync: If the airbag (SRS) warning light is illuminated after installation, a simple ‘Setup SDM Primary Key in BCM’ procedure must be performed with a compatible high-level scan tool. This syncs the BCM with the airbag module.
  • Brake Pedal Position Relearn: Some models may require this procedure to ensure the brake lights and stability control systems function correctly. This also typically requires a professional scan tool.

Disclaimer: Always consult a factory service manual for your specific vehicle for detailed instructions and torque specs. These steps are a general guide.

What exactly is a BCM ‘Cloning Service’?

Cloning is the process where we transfer the vital, vehicle-specific information—like the VIN, mileage, and security key data—from your original BCM to the replacement unit. This makes the new module a perfect electronic match for your car, eliminating the need for dealership programming.

Do I have to send you my original module?

Yes. For the cloning service to work, we need your original module to extract the data. After we program the replacement, we will ship both your original module and the ready-to-install replacement back to you.

Will this 2008-2009 G8 BCM fix my specific problem?

This module corrects issues directly caused by a failing BCM, such as the symptoms listed above. It’s crucial to properly diagnose the problem first, as similar symptoms can sometimes be caused by wiring or other components.

What if my original BCM is completely dead or not communicating?

In many cases, even if the BCM isn’t functioning in the car, we can still extract the necessary data on our benchtop equipment. Please contact us if your module is severely damaged (e.g., by fire or water) to discuss options.

What happens if the airbag light comes on after I install it?

This is not uncommon. It simply means the new BCM needs to be electronically ‘introduced’ to the airbag system (SDM). A professional mechanic can perform the ‘Setup SDM Primary Key in BCM’ procedure with a scan tool to resolve this.
